2 die in rocket attacks

Published May 18, 2002

QUETTA, May 17: Several rockets landed and exploded in Kohlu township, on Friday some 500kms from here, seriously injuring two Marri tribesmen, officials sources said.

“At least eight rocket were fired by unknown people on Kohlu township in the wee hours of Friday,” a senior officer of the Kohlu administration confirmed adding that of which exploded in a house killing a donkey and seriously injuring two persons. Seven exploded in uninhabited area.

The injured were rushed to Civil Hospital.

According to sources one rocket hit the main transmission line to Kohlu and suspended power to the entire area.

Sources said the culprits wanted to target Frontier Corps posts. Rocket attacks have become a routine in Kohlu area.

There have been many incident of land mine blast too claiming over a dozen lives in the last 18 months.
